In a street, there are five houses, painted five different colors. In each house live a person of different nationality. The five homeowners each drink a different kind of beverage, smoke a different brand of cigarette and keep a different pet.
The Brit [Englishman] lives in the red house.
The Swede has a dog.
The Dane drinks tea.
The green house is on the left of the white house.
The owner of the green house drinks coffee.
The person who smokes Pall Mall has birds.
In the yellow house, they smoke Dunhill.
The man living in the middle house drinks milk.
The Norwegian lives in the first house.
The man who smokes Blend lives next to the house with cats.
The horseman lives next to the man who smokes Dunhill.
The man who smokes Blue Master drinks beer.
The German smokes Prince.
The Norwegian lives next door to the blue house.
The man who smokes Blend has a neighbor who drinks water.
Who has the fish?
